Synopsis
Nicaragua Was Our Home is a report on the tragic plight of the Miskito Indians, whose villages have been razed and who have suffered terrible human loss as a result of “mistakes” now admitted by the Sandanista government.
Awards
1986: Sundance Film Festival: Nominated for Grand Jury Prize (Documentary)
1985: Chicago Film Festival: Nominated for Best Documentary
